  • What does "buy" mean in ALSN activity?

    "Buy" means an investor increased their reported position in ALSN compared to the prior reporting period. This reflects growing exposure to ALLISON TRANSMISSION HOLDING (ALSN) rather than necessarily a brand-new position (though new positions also appear as buys when prior quantity was zero).
